....starting a new thread in the correct place. I don't belong to/contribute to any other message boards, so forgive me for not knowing the etiquette.....

Today will be the last day of my third week on NAL, and I am pretty happy with the results so far. Although not anywhere near "safe" levels of drinking yet, for three weeks in a row I have consumed half of my pre-TSM units and have not had any blackout moments or done anything I regret.

I am certainly not feeling any physical urges to drink right now at all, it's all in my head. There were several times this last week that I instinctively opened a beer or poured myself a drink, realized that I didn't want it but drank it anyway. This week coming up I am going to really pay attention to this behavior and attempt to be in better control.

So far this has been easier than I thought it would be, but still pretty dang hard. I am a creature of routines and habits and for the last 7 or 8 years several of my routines and habits have revolved around drinking. I do feel a little rudderless right now. Trying to find new things/old things that I used to enjoy to occupy my time. I read two novels this week, which is something I haven't done in ages.

Perhaps today will be an AF day? We'll see....

sounds like you're a model TSM student - keep up the good work :)

just be aware that you may be in a "honeymoon" period & your consumption may rise to, or even above, pre-TSM levels after the first few weeks. don't be discouraged, your consumption should then drop off again

5 Weeks in, and no significant change (yet) in my consumption, although it's down a little bit. I can say that this week consisted of all moderate (for me) drinking, no binging, no getting drunk. Still drinking every day. I'm a creature of habit that needs to find some new habits....

It actually makes me question if I am tracking right. Each day of my drinking consisted of either 3 beers or 2 beers and a whiskey. The beers I usually drink are higher around a 6% ABV, but it still surprises me that this could count as almost 6 american units

I had a conversation with my wife, mentioned that I was a month in and noticed if she had noticed any difference. Her reply was that she "hadn't noticed me", which I took to mean that she hadn't seen me act like a fool/embarrass her/say awful things that I don't mean. I'll call that a small victory.....

Sounds to me like you are going to be just fine. Keep your eyes on October, -that's where I suspect big change lurks. If you only have the energy to work on one thing, -I would work more on new habits/lifestyle changes, rather than micro-managing your consumption. The pill combined with the former usually takes care of the latter. She is a difficult mistress to replace, alcohol, but in the end she must be replaced.
